CJI BR Gavai highlights Dr.  Ambedkar’s central role as chief architect of Constitution at Osmania University

Chief Justice of India Bhushan R. Gavai spoke on the theme “Constitution of India: The Contribution of Dr B R Ambedkar” at Osmania University in Hyderabad this evening. He highlighted Dr.  Ambedkar’s central role as chief architect of the Constitution, especially his efforts in embedding liberty, equality, fraternity and the mechanisms needed to protect those rights, such as Article 32, the right to constitutional remedies. Justice Gavai emphasised that the Constitution must adapt alongside society.
 
He noted its dynamic expansion, most notably through judicial interpretation of Article 21, extending it to education, health, dignity, environment, etc in keeping with Ambedkar’s vision. Reflecting Dr.  Ambedkar’s warning, Justice Gavai underscored that political democracy alone isn’t enough without addressing social and economic inequality, otherwise democracy becomes unsustainable. CJI reiterated that the legislature, executive and judiciary must operate under Constitutional supremacy, placing democratic values above all including Parliament itself.
